<p>School changed this year for the majority of freshman at the USC School of Cinematic Arts. Driven, talented future media makers normally waited until their sophomore year to produce any major media through the program, but this year USC partnered with Ph.D. candidate Jeff Watson to produce <em>Reality</em>, an alternate reality game focused on media creation.</p>
<p><em>Reality</em>, which just completed its first season, is one part trading card game, one part media creation tool, and one part web portal. Three hundred unique cards, color-coded by type and designed to fit together, were handed out to students who unraveled a series of clues leading to the game’s secret campus headquarters or tucked away for discovery as the game progressed. As students discovered other students who were playing, they made “deals” by trading or pooling cards that led to collaborative projects and then published their work to <em>Reality</em>’s <a href="http://reality.usc.edu/">web portal</a> so other students could rate and review the projects. Winning projects earned interesting rewards, like meeting industry professionals, for the creators.</p>
<p><strong>Designing Reality</strong><br />
When USC pulled together a team to design <em>Reality</em>, they had one goal in mind: to give incoming freshmen the opportunity to collaborate with other students and sharpen their skills before their sophomore year.  Watson was approached for the project because his dissertation is on <a href="http://remotedevice.net/about/research/">transmedia interaction design</a>. He put together a team with Simon Wiscombe, with Tracy Fullerton as an advisor.</p>
<p>Watson didn’t want students to feel like they had to join the game. Designed as an alternate reality game, Watson felt that students had to come to the game driven by their own curiosity for it to be truly successful, thus the typical ARG mysterious message that pulls players into the game world.  Here’s how students describe their initiation into the game:</p>
<p>“When I started playing the game, I was eating dinner with a friend and she got a call from another friend of mine asking her to come to Fluor Tower,” says Ben Chance, a Film &amp; Television Production major and one of the most active players. “My friend asked if I could come because I was sitting there. There was a pause. After a moment, I was told I could come. We were told we were going to a secret meeting. We came into the room and there were 8 people there and they all had their cards on the floor. I remember telling my friend, ‘This semester just got a whole lot more interesting.’”</p>
<p>“I remember getting a text from my friend Miranda Due,” recalls Allison Tate-Cortese, another Film &amp; Television Production major.  ”She had gotten an email from <em>Reality</em> (an email address she didn’t know). It had a cryptic message saying that if you can decode this email, it would tell you where to go for further instructions. It had a bunch of jumbled letters at the bottom. I was pretty shocked off the bat, it was out of the blue and came in a few days before class started.”</p>
<p><strong>Team Formation</strong><br />
One interesting aspect of the slow uptake of the game (as intentionally hoped for) was the ability of those early adaptors to game the system.</p>
<p>“One of the things that helped get me into USC is that I’m a motivated person around challenges so when a challenge was presented to beat out other freshman students in the production of visual media it sounded like a lot of fun,” noted Chance.  ”We formed a group of ten people early on and that was unheard of, other groups were getting together in twos and threes.  One of my friends, Josh Rappaport, asked if I knew about the game and when I said yeah I’m in a group of 10 people he was shocked.  He only knew about 4 or 5 other people playing the game so when he heard about a group of 10 other people playing the game that was unheard of.”</p>
<p>These early adopters dubbed themselves Marra and created an “exclusivity contract” to ensure all members participating in a challenge would get credited for the project. It became impossible for other players to beat this collective force and created some real heat between freshmen. The prizes for the game included things like class recognition, exclusive meetings with top professionals like Robert Zemeckis and famous Hollywood producers: one student even walked away with an internship offer based on the meeting.</p>
<p>Eventually, a rival group formed called the Tribe. While we didn’t talk to a Tribe player, Tate-Cortese, one of Marra’s members, described the Tribe’s rationale as “there are more students outside of Mara than within so why don’t we compete with that and use our massive amount of people to compete.”  It worked.  Before the Tribe’s formation, Marra won five weeks in a row. Once The Tribe started working together, they won five weeks in a row.</p>
<p>After this rivalry, a resolution emerged as a “forbidden deal.” “About week eight [of the rivalry] maybe, there were three Mara members working on a deal,” Chance explained. “Across the hall, all the Tribe members invited us into a meeting and we observed them and talked to them about what we wanted.  One of the members threw out the idea of doing  a ‘super project.’” The idea stuck.  Chance got intrigued about a Romeo and Juliet style deal and they shot a <a href="http://reality.usc.edu/deals/the-game-a-forbidden-deal/">cross-team deal</a>, uniting the teams for the first time.</p>
<p><strong>Prototyping Challenges</strong><br />
While gameplay of this nature is emergent, it is worth examining why the designers made the decisions to include elements like forced collaboration that led to this type of group deal making.</p>
<p>“Our initial design didn’t have cards at all,” noted Watson.  ”It was much more like something like <a href="http://sf0.org/">SF0</a> <em>–</em>a collaborative production game played through a web portal, full stop.”  Fullerton, Watson’s advisor on the project, pressed for more. As she explained,</p>
<blockquote><p>From the beginning, the primary goal of the project was to get students talking, working, and forming lasting social bonds amongst the various divisions of the school . . . . The fact is that some students are more online-focused than others, and we didn’t want to make something that privileged that way of interacting.  A face-to-face mechanic, that prompted casual discussion and ramped up to collaboration was what was needed.</p></blockquote>
<p>Watson had been toying with an interlocking card game system for years, and that became the basis for the revised design. The initial deck design featured media artifact cards as well as action cards that would direct the making, but that still wasn’t flexible enough for what the team wanted. Finally, the team designed a deck carefully balanced between <a href="http://reality.usc.edu/how-to-play/">four types of cards</a>: Maker, Property, Special, and People. The cards were flexible enough to provide the type of random prompt generation the design team wanted while still remaining portable enough to facilitate the face-to-face interactions necessary to the game’s success. After the team developed the game’s mechanics on a collaborative wiki and creating a set of test cards, Wiscombe helped refine the experience and translate it into a fleshed-out deck of cards.</p>
<p><img title="reality_connector" src="http://www.argn.com/images/reality_connector.jpg" alt="" width="560" height="315" /></p>
<p>Watson gave one example of the reasoning behind the team’s card design decisions.  They wanted everyone to start with fairly different cards so they could discover, trade, and share new cards by talking to other players.  ”If everyone had the same 10 cards in their starter pack, players wouldn’t be curious about what other players had in their packs . . . so we looked at the approximate size of what we expected would be our start-up player base — we designed for around 200 players — and then did the math from there.”</p>
<p>The team got to know their target audience extremely well, and adjusted the design accordingly. As Watson explains,</p>
<blockquote><p>There’s a temptation in designing games for institutional interventions that says you should make your game maximally scalable such that other institutions can easily port it into their programs. In my experience, designing for scale from the start depersonalizes and flattens games. Our mandate was to make something that would intrigue, galvanize, and mobilize our players, and we felt that the best way to do this was to create a genuinely tailor-made experience, something that couldn’t happen anywhere else and that was precisely tuned to this particular player population. That was our priority.”</p></blockquote>
<p>Despite the team’s focus on crafting a project particular to the USC School of Cinematic Arts, their game produced quite a few mechanics that could be readily transferable, including the way the cards link to a web-based collaborative production game.</p>
<p>Of course, design processes are never ideal.  The beginning of the semester quickly approached and the team needed to playtest the system with limited time. They were able to bring in members of a<a href="http://remotedevice.net/project/peg-la/">local pervasive gaming group</a> to help test the mechanics and make sure they were headed in the right direction. In the end, the inaugural season of <em>Reality</em> proved to be its real playtest beyond figuring out the mechanics.</p>
<p><strong>Design Philosophy</strong><br />
At its heart, Watson made something quite different from many ARGs.  Even with a background in making traditional story-driven ARGs, he finds the mantra, “It’s all about the story” to be counter-productive.  ”Design your ARG experiences so that they function procedurally — that is, create an actual game that drives participation and play among your audience such that the play itself generates the experience,” Watson argues.  ”In our case, we had a lot of eager young media-makers to work with, and so we were able to leverage their creative and performative motivations in order to generate the overall experience.”  This seems like a much needed perspective change, focusing on the mechanic and using the story as an impetus for gameplay.  Watson allowed the players to tell their own more meaningful story about personal ambition and competition and collaboration.</p>
<p><strong>What’s Next</strong><br />
It sounds like <em>Reality</em> will return again if student sentiment is any signal.  The two students we spoke with both admitted that <em>Reality</em> was their favorite part of their freshman fall semester.  They are sad to see it go, and are excited to be a part of the next iteration (even if it is just talking to next year’s freshman about the experience).  Beyond the sheer fun, Tate-Cortese found the game to be an exceptional learning experience. “I think the game was brilliant because it created an incredible space for experimentation and growth.  It was brilliant because you felt safe because you can try things that were outside of your comfort zone, but you didn’t have to worry about a grade accompanied with it.”  She wants to be a director, but got to experiment in all of the different roles in a production.</p>
<p>“Everyone I spoke to in the upper classes wishes they had this experience,” Tate-Cortese said. “It speaks to the future of education and film production, and it just really proves that they are cutting edge and at the forefront of film production and education.” It also allowed for several students outside of SCA to participate in the production process and Chance thinks they are even better equipped to be SCA students (many of them want to transfer) than the SCA students who didn’t participate in <em>Reality</em>.</p>

<p>Every so often you come across one of those strokes of brilliance that makes you ask the really important questions: Is there another way of doing things? Is everything I know about XYZ-topic completely wrong? Why aren’t we all doing this? (And, of course, why didn’t I think of that?)</p>
<p>Recently I came across one such idea. HubSpot, thought leaders<em>extraordinaires</em> in the inbound marketing realm, recently became the first B2B business ever to launch an Alternate Reality Game (ARG) to promote their products.</p>
<p>The premise is simple: HubSpot invented a company, <a href="http://kronusmedia.com/">Kronus Media</a>, and told all of their followers that Kronus had issued a Cease &amp; Desist order that forced HubSpot to shut down <a href="http://inboundmarketing.com/">inboundmarketing.com</a>, their thought leadership arm. The same day, HubSpot launched a Ning network — <a href="http://captaininbound.ning.com/">captaininbound.ning.com</a> — dedicated to solving the mystery behind the evil Kronus Media and their motivations, and eventually to get inboundmarketing.com back up and running. To solve the mystery, the proprietor of the network (who goes by the name “Captain Inbound” to protect him/herself from violating a non-disclosure agreement) points out “clues” left on HubSpot’s various social media sites and asks people for help figuring out what they might mean.</p>
<p>Here’s why this is brilliant:</p>
<ol>
<li><strong>It’s instantly engaging.</strong> The Inbound Marketing University is shut down?! How could they <em>do</em> something like that?!</li>
<li><strong>It requires subscription.</strong> Part of the fun of the game is discovering clues. Where are these clues? On HubSpot’s Facebook page, in their Twitter updates, on their blog, etc. In order to find these clues, you have to be actively monitoring HubSpot’s social media accounts.</li>
<li><strong>It promotes followers. </strong>There is tremendous incentive to be an active part of a game like this for several reasons. First, it’s reasonably high-profile, which means that there are lots of eyeballs scanning your content. Second, participating in — never mind <em>winning</em> — the game gives you a chance to show off your analytical skills. And third, it levels the playing field for exposure. Anyone can find a clue, anyone can solve a riddle, and anyone can win the game. So why wouldn’t you participate?</li>
<li><strong>It promotes an ideology.</strong> The very nature of this game is to pit those people interested in the Inbound Marketing University — who are, for the most part, modern and forward-thinking marketers — against Kronus Media, a company that represents the exact ideology against which Inbound Marketing rebels. The success of HubSpot as a company revolves around their ability to make people understand that this dichotomy exists, and that HubSpot’s side is the side to be on. This game helps to reinforce that idea.</li>
<li><strong>It creates a positive sentiment.</strong> I don’t know what this game will do to drive business for HubSpot — I’m thinking it won’t drive much, but that’s me being skeptical. To be honest, though, I don’t know that HubSpot is thinking about this game in terms of ROI. Any return that they’ll get from this game will be entirely metaphysical in nature. There is an unspoken value in the number of times someone says, “Hey, did you hear about that cool game that HubSpot’s running?” To have the words “cool” and “HubSpot” in the same sentence, multiplied by a couple of thousand, adds up to the kind of achievement that they probably couldn’t have accomplished otherwise.</li>
<li><strong>It happens in a natural environment.</strong> HubSpot isn’t asking you log into some third-party website to access the game. You don’t have to download anything, you’re not using some kind of game widget. You’re doing things that you were probably already doing: interacting with HubSpot on their blog and on Twitter and Facebook. You already do that (or if you don’t, it’s really easy to start doing it). So there’s no barrier to entry.</li>
</ol>

		<description><![CDATA[So, it looks like Iron Man 2 is joining the ARG movement.  The rabbithole for this appears to have been a Stark Industries recruiter wandering around Comic-con.  Here&#8217;s a link to what was on the business cards she was handing out.  This will take you to the website: www.starkindustriesnow.com which has a letter from &#8220;Tony&#8221; [...]]]></description>
			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>So, it looks like Iron Man 2 is joining the ARG movement.  The rabbithole for this appears to have been a Stark Industries recruiter wandering around Comic-con.  Here&#8217;s a <a href="http://www.comicbookmovie.com/fansites/BrentSprecher/news/?a=8765">link</a> to what was on the business cards she was handing out.  This will take you to the website: www.starkindustriesnow.com which has a letter from &#8220;Tony&#8221; and a link to apply for employment with Stark Industries.  Some of the questions are fairly stereotypical like employment history, but others like this: &#8220;What term describes the superposition of two or more waves resulting in a new wave pattern?&#8221; are a little trickier.  I applied, but have yet to receive anything, maybe I didn&#8217;t get the physics questions rights&#8230; In addition, several &#8216;news articles&#8217; have been released: <a href="http://www.superherohype.com/imageGallery/Iron_Man/Iron_Man_2/Movie_Stills/large/hr_Iron_Man_2_Secret.jpg">link</a> and <a href="http://screenrant.com/iron-man-2-viral-marketing-vic-37420/iron-man2-viral2/">here</a>.  The best people can do is look at what words are darkened, and the clipping below of the man walking on air.  Is it related?  This is definitely generating some buzz, but from an ARG perspective, a LOT of people are scratching their heads trying to figure what the clues mean and what to do with them. <p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">In July, Logan received a notebook in the mail, along with news that his friend Matt Selby had committed suicide. Logan started posting pictures of the notebook’s pages to his blog, attempting to decipher its meaning. But in September, Logan disappeared, and now his friends are all trying to find him. There’s only one problem: Neither Logan nor his friends exist.</p>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">They’re characters in the Alternate Reality Game Just Another Fool. Alternate Reality Games, or ARGs, blur the lines between reality and the game by telling the stories through various on- and off-line media, such as websites, social networks, mail, video, phone calls, and even real-life events. The players have to solve puzzles contained in these media in order to advance the story.</p>
<h2 style="marg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px; font-size: 15px; font-weight: bold; padding: 0px;">The Future of Entertainment</h2>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">ARGs started out as a form of viral marketing for various products. The first big ARG was The Beast, set in the fictional world of the movie <em>“A.I.”</em> There have been highly successful ARGs for movies like <em>“The Dark Knight,”</em> <em>“District 9,”</em> and <em>“Pirates of the Caribbean.”</em> One of the most famous ARGs was called <em>“IloveBees,”</em> which was a promotion campaign for the massively popular video game <em>“Halo 2.”</em> Even though these ARGs were essentially giant advertisements, the players still found them incredibly entertaining.</p>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">“If a <em>‘Halo’</em> fan hears about an ARG about <em>‘Halo’</em> or a <em>‘Terminator’</em> fan hears about the [<em>‘Sarah Connor Chronicles’</em>] ARG, they would jump at the opportunity to participate in a story,” said Tyler Parrott, a first year student at Colby College, who has been playing ARGs for over three years. “ARGs have gotten me in touch with some incredible stories. Enitech got me watching [<em>‘Sarah Connor Chronicles’</em>] and now I love the series.”</p>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">Steve Peters, who has been developing ARGs professionally since 2005, sees ARGs as a new art form. Peters is the Chief Experience Architect for No Mimes Media and has worked on ARGs for <em>“The Dark Knight”</em> and <em>“Pirates of the Caribbean.”</em> “What hooked me was when the game called me while I was at lunch,” Peters said. “It’s the future of entertainment.” In recent months, there has been an explosion of grassroots ARGs run by fans, for fans. These “unofficial” ARGs have met differing levels of success. This is largely due to the fact that the people working behind the scenes, known as “Puppetmasters” in the ARG community, are required to balance the game with real-life obligations.</p>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">On the <a style="color: #005476; text-decoration: none; padding: 0px; margin: 0px;" href="http://unfiction.com/">Unfiction.com</a> forums, the largest online ARG community, these grassroots campaigns now outnumber the “official” games 2-to-1, and they have a comparable number of players. “ARGs sort of blur the line between creator [and his or her] characters and the players in a way,” Regina Erbs, a webmaster from Lima, Ohio said. “Being a part of the action is a lot of fun.”</p>
<h2 style="marg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px; font-size: 15px; font-weight: bold; padding: 0px;">Riddle Me This, Riddle Me That</h2>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">When “Logan” disappeared, his friend Joshua hacked into his blog and started updating on how the search was going. Following Logan’s advice, he got rid of the notebook by mailing it to Tyler Parrott, .</p>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">Parrott then posted a YouTube video of the notebook’s pages. That was when Erbs spotted a pattern of numbers that turned out to be a phone number. When players called it, they heard “Logan.” Using the information he gave them, they were able to correctly answer a riddle, and the players were each sent pages of a new notebook. It was through their teamwork that they were able to advance the story.</p>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">“Ultimately, the main pull is the interactivity, the challenging puzzles, and the community that forms as a result of these games,” Parrott said. Parrott, who goes by the online persona of Dav Flamerock, is a community leader on the Unfiction forums, and a highly prominent player of the fan-created “<em>Just Another Fool</em>.”</p>
<h2 style="marg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px; font-size: 15px; font-weight: bold; padding: 0px;">Online Family, For Better or For Worse</h2>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">According to Parrott, the large interest in these games is due to the player community’s involvement in the story. “I have made some amazing friends through these games,” Parrott said. These games are simply impossible to play by yourself, according to Erbs. The community is all-important to figuring out riddles and advancing the story. “So much of these games are about sharing information,” Erbs said. “If Dav hadn’t posted the video of the first notebook, he might not have noticed there was a phone number hidden in it.”</p>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">But it’s not all roses and butterflies. The community can create problems as well, particularly in grassroots ARGs. The stories are often inspired by conversations on other forum sites like SomethingAwful.com, which is where <em>“Just Another Fool”</em> and a related ARG, <em>“Marble Hornets”</em>, started. Because these games start in public forums, there tends to be a lot of what ARG players call “gamejacking,” which is when people who aren’t playing the game attempt to divert the course of the story by pretending to be characters.</p>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">When Peters was running a game for Cisco Systems, Inc., they created profiles for several of the game characters on LinkedIn.com. Someone attempted to “gamejack” them by creating a profile on LinkedIn.com, claiming to work at the same fictional company. This person then sent puzzles to players while claiming to be an official part of the game. But despite these annoyances, most players still find the games very rewarding. “Challenging puzzles &#8230; engage players and make them feel accomplished when they complete a seemingly impossible task,” Parrott said.</p>
<h2 style="marg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px; font-size: 15px; font-weight: bold; padding: 0px;">Immersing Yourself</h2>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">ARGs are always evolving, as the Puppetmasters discover new ways to deliver their content. And though the community is much more mainstream than it was ten years ago, Peters says it isn’t quite enough yet. “The next step is for [ARGs] to go mainstream in a big way,” Peters said. “What does a movie look like when it’s not limited to the screen?” But with the amount of media that we are inundated with, it’s difficult to tell the difference between a legitimate website and the beginning of a game. The easiest way to find a game to join, according to Erbs and Parrott, is to check out <a style="color: #005476; text-decoration: none; padding: 0px; margin: 0px;" href="http://unfiction.com/">http://unfiction.com</a> or<a style="color: #005476; text-decoration: none; padding: 0px; margin: 0px;" href="http://argn.com/">http://argn.com</a>.</p>
<p style="padding-top: 0px; padding-right: 15px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; margin-top: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-bottom: 10px; margin-left: 0px;">“Go to the News &amp; Rumors section of <a style="color: #005476; text-decoration: none; padding: 0px; margin: 0px;" href="http://unfiction.com/">Unfiction.com</a> and find a trailhead that looks promising,” Parrott said. And from there, as ARG players say, go down the rabbit hole.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I just had a great phone conversation about Alternate Reality Gaming with Jake Kahle.  In it we discussed that the majority of ARGs are being used to market video games, movies, tv, et cetera. But I&#8217;ve been thinking what else can we use them for?  And since most of these ARGs are being run very large scale, can small businesses possibly get in on this new&#8230; tool? game? technique? life?  So I thought of two different scenarios in which ARGs could be used to 1.) build community and ties 2.) be implemented by a small business</p>
<p>1.)<span style="text-decoration: underline;"> The Secrets of the Omega Society</span>:Where do most people today build a significant number of their life long connections? Colleges! So I thought why couldn&#8217;t a college especially during orientation, begin and run an ARG.  The plot could surround a secret society (the Omega Society) known for having the best dorms, best seats at sport&#8217;s events, private galas, the top students, etc. (all kinds of good rumors to get students involved).  The rabbit hole could be something like a clue in the orientation pamphlet (perhaps the secret societies&#8217; symbol is a greek character Omega?) or perhaps, there is a website for students to log into to create a social profile for the university and located at the bottom is a link a la the Net. Maybe a short &#8216;home video&#8217; style runs on campus tv at 1 am that is a student hiding in the omege societies lair (he gives his name which if payers look up takes them either to his facebook page, or to an article he wrote for the university 4 years ago on the society). Either way, the game should leave clues that require a range of different types of students to complete.  There should be math clues to encourage those students to become involved, items placed near sporting equipment so those s inclined would see them.  In addition, bury the various clues in the different orientation events in order to drive new students to these to build up attendance and traditional ice breaker techniques.  Recruit different RAs, tourguides, freshman advisors, an even professors to act as puppet masters.  The ARG would culminate in an initiation ceremony involving the winning team, and prizes awarded in the form of box seats to sporting events, a nice quad for Omega Society members.  The nice thing about this one is that it could be possible to recruit one year&#8217;s winners to be the next year&#8217;s puppetmasters!</p>
<p>2.<span style="text-decoration: underline;"> Secret of the Stolen Recipe:</span> For this one we&#8217;ll go back to my first post about a small restaurant here in Missoula, MT.  Here is a way for a small business to possibly run an ARG on their own.  The rabbit hole for this one would be to place a new item on the restaurant menu, but have a piece of tape or something to look last minute placed over the item with a note saying: &#8220;due to unforeseen circumstances this menu item has been pulled&#8221;.  Waiters/waitresses acting as puppetmasters if asked could vaguely reference someone trying to buy out the restaurant which if looked up would send to a social profile or perhaps a few fake &#8216;news&#8217; sites talking about th same guy buying up buildings in the area, maybe there is a clue written in the bathrooms saying: &#8220;I know who has the recipe&#8221; with some some numbers scrawled below (the numbers lead to a GPS coordinate AND a google maps location both with a new clue of some kind).  The idea is that this gentlemen is stole this prize winning (another hook!) recipe in order to keep the restaurant from earning a bunch more money so he could buy it for some nefarious purpose (perhaps to get to the hidden prohibition-era treasure hidden in the building?) The key here would be try and keep as many of the clues in the restaurant thus driving customers back to find out the next clue, and to involve LOCAL scenery and people as much as possible.   The goal would be to generate more community feelings around the restaurant, increase brand awareness, and bring in new customers.  Many of the clues would require man hours but little cost. Maybe paying for a po box to drive someone there, some URLS to create dummy pages, maybe a two day ad in the local paper, but that would be about it. And even those if done write could be cut out all together.  The culmination of the game could be a date and time, along with the gps coordinates of the restaurant.  The time would be for when the restaurant is not open, and whoever shows up with the correct password could be treated to a free sampling of the &#8216;stolen recipe&#8217;.</p>
<p>These are just two of the many different ways in which ARGs could be used in ways other than for tv, movies, and video games.  The key is that people have fun. If you have any other ideas for innovative ways to use ARGs please, pass them along.</p>
